    Blackmagic Design 16TB Media Module for URSA Cine 12K Introduced

    Blackmagic Design has expanded their Media Module lineup with the introduction of a brand new 16TB variant, doubling the storage capability of their beforehand obtainable 8TB possibility. The brand new media module is designed particularly for the URSA Cine 12K LF digicam system and provides skilled filmmakers prolonged recording capabilities for high-resolution productions.

    The Media Module options 16TB of M.2 SSD storage that installs immediately into the digicam’s media bay. The module helps as much as 12-bit Blackmagic RAW information and H.264 proxy information, with knowledge storage charges reaching as much as 1,432 MB/s at 24 fps. This efficiency stage allows recording on the highest resolutions and body charges for prolonged durations.

    The storage resolution makes use of Blackmagic’s proprietary media format and have to be formatted throughout the digicam. For workflow integration, the module is designed to work seamlessly with the elective Blackmagic Media Dock, which permits for hot-swappable operation throughout media transfers.

    Workflow Integration

    Past primary storage, the Media Module capabilities as what Blackmagic describes as “a Cloud Retailer Mini constructed into your digicam.” Customers can entry information immediately over high-speed 10G Ethernet connections. The module will be simply faraway from the digicam and loaded right into a Blackmagic Media Dock for transferring media to networks or to Blackmagic Cloud for collaborative workflows.

    For customers preferring conventional media codecs, Blackmagic additionally provides an elective Media Module CF variant that includes twin CFexpress slots, accommodating present media investments.

    Availability and Pricing

    The Blackmagic Design Media Module (16TB) is now obtainable for pre-order at $2,965 USD. Every unit features a protecting plastic case for storage and transport safety. The module comes with Blackmagic Design’s commonplace restricted 1-year producer guarantee.

    The brand new 16TB capability represents a big improve in recording time for productions requiring prolonged takes or a number of digicam setups, addressing the storage calls for of contemporary high-resolution cinematography workflows.
